Company Name: ASTEMO AMERICAS, INC. Job Family: Engineering Job Description: Job Summary In this role, under the supervision of a Lead Engineer, you'll support technology development for a production (and/or developing) xEV inverter(s) at Hitachi Astemo America. You'll be responsible for understanding customer requirements and then working with a global engineering team to design/develop an inverter/power control unit to meet customer needs. This role work plan is hybrid structure (3 days on-site) Job Responsibilities: Lead and/or support mechanical packaging development activities for new xEV Inverter business in Hitachi Astemo Americas Plans and manage activities for multiple projects to ensure goals or objectives are accomplished within a prescribed timeframe. Receive, evaluate, and utilize customer engineering requirements and work with global team to provide optimum inverter design for each application. Facilitate accurate & timely inverter program technical communication between OEM customers to the US / Japan design teams, Hitachi manufacturing sites, and suppliers. Participate with Hitachi US & Japan Design Engineering organizations in the original design / existing design improvements / performance validation / production launch activities of xEV inverters for various automotive powertrain products applications. Create and/or oversee 3-D CAD, 2-D drawings, CAE or other technical information/specifications as needed for product design. Provide as needed on-site support to the internal and external inverter manufacturing sites for various engineering duties during sample and mass production timing. Support various types of product pricing, quoting, and cost investigation activities. Prepare various types of technical data / information documents using industry standard PC based software programs (i.e.: Word, Excel, PowerPoint, Outlook, CAD, CAE, etc.) Support product validation testing, prototype build and test, and other engineering deliverables in the development phase of product life cycle. Lead and/or support post SORP VEC activities to reduce production costs and/or improve quality. Qualifications: Knowledge, Skills and Abilities: Possess experience with 3-D CAD creation and 2-D drawing creation. Possess experience with Mechanical CAE (thermal, structural, etc) Understanding of electrified vehicle system and integration. Experience interfacing with customers and/or suppliers to explain technical documents/drawings/information. High level technical problem-solving skills. High level interpersonal skills to collaborate internally and externally. Experience managing projects from concept through execution. The ideal candidate is preferred to have the following qualifications: Possess a MSME. 7 yrs. of practical automotive design experience Demonstrated accomplishments developing automotive inverters or similar devices Highly Proficient with Solidworks or CATIA 3-D CAD creation and 2-D drawing creation. Mechanical design CAE experience for automotive inverters (thermal, structural, etc) Experience with quotation activities (BOM estimation, etc) for new products. Experience with tolerance stack-ups, GD&T, DFMEA, DRBFM, and DFSS. Demonstrated ability to manage projects from concept through execution. Fluent in both the English and Japanese languages. Education: Possess at minimum a BSME Experience: Minimum 5 years practical work experience designing automotive powertrain components (drive Inverters preferred).
